DR Congo war: Rape survivors recall horror of Goma jailbreak | BBC News


Warning: This video contains distressing content, including descriptions of rape, from the start. Women have recalled being raped at a prison in eastern Democratic Republic of Congo, as chaos broke out after rebels advanced on Goma city. Rwandan-backed M23 rebels closed in on the city on 27 January after a rapid advance through the region. By morning, about 4,000 male inmates had broken out of the prison - they had also apparently started a fire which tore through the compound as they tried to escape - but few of the women managed to get away. A total of 132 female prisoners and at least 25 children burned to death according to two sources. A UN official told the BBC that "at least 153 women had perished", quoting "reliable sources in the prison".
